- What does a metal roof cost in Vermont?
- HomeGuide puts $9 to $16 per square foot installed for standing seam (a national cost survey, not a Vermont figure). Angi puts $9,400 to $32,600 for a typical project, averaging about $19,000, and Zonda's 2025 Cost vs. Value Report averages a metal roof replacement near $51,900 nationally against about $31,900 for asphalt shingles. All three are national surveys rather than Vermont figures. A Vermont roof carries snow-load detailing, snow guards and ice-dam work that a national average does not price, and mountain and rural access adds to labour, so read these as the shape of the number rather than the number itself.
